Cold front 11 arrives in Mexico with Halloween

Cold front number 11 moves over southeastern Mexico and the Yucatán Peninsula, bringing cold temperatures and frost to various regions just in time for Halloween and Day of the Dead. The National Water Commission (Conagua) forecasts lows of -5 to 0 degrees in mountainous areas of states like Chihuahua and Puebla. Rain is expected in the southeast, with showers in other areas.

The National Water Commission (Conagua) reported that cold front 11 will affect northern, central, and eastern Mexico, with a polar air mass maintaining cold conditions and frost in the Northern Plateau and Central Plateau. During Friday morning, minimum temperatures of -5 to 0 degrees Celsius are forecast in mountainous areas of Baja California, Chihuahua, Durango, Coahuila, Nuevo León, Hidalgo, Mexico State, Tlaxcala, Puebla, and Veracruz. In other mountainous areas of Sonora, San Luis Potosí, Zacatecas, Aguascalientes, Jalisco, Michoacán, Guanajuato, Querétaro, Morelos, and Oaxaca, lows will range from 0 to 5 degrees.

Regarding precipitation, Conagua expects rain in Veracruz, Oaxaca, Chiapas, Tabasco, and Campeche, intervals of showers in Michoacán and Guerrero, and isolated rains in Puebla, Sinaloa, Durango, Nayarit, Jalisco, Colima, Yucatán, and Quintana Roo. On Friday, October 31, the front will enter the Caribbean Sea and cease affecting the Mexican Republic.

On Saturday, November 1, the associated polar air mass will modify its thermal characteristics, allowing a gradual rise in temperatures across much of the territory. However, a new cold front 12 will approach from Saturday to Monday, November 3, interacting with a low-pressure channel in the northeast and east, increasing the likelihood of rains and showers in those regions. This front will cause strong wind gusts in the north and, starting Sunday, showers and heavy rains in the northeast, east, southeast, and Yucatán Peninsula.
